    Why Moodle's Calendar Isn't Enough for Students

    Moodle is one of the most widely used open-source learning management systems in the world, powering courses at thousands of universities. However, its built-in calendar has a critical limitation: it only displays assignments and events that instructors manually create in Moodle. Many Moodle instructors, especially those at larger universities, upload a comprehensive syllabus PDF and expect students to manage their own schedules. The result is a disconnect between what appears on Moodle's calendar and what's actually due in the course.

    The Moodle Calendar Gap

    Moodle's calendar pulls from assignment activities, quiz activities, and manual calendar events. But reading assignments, research paper milestones, study guides, and participation deadlines are typically only found in the syllabus. Students who rely solely on Moodle's calendar frequently miss these critical deadlines.

    Does Moodle have a calendar export?

    Moodle has a built-in calendar that shows events and deadlines entered by instructors. You can export it via iCal URL, but this only includes items instructors add to Moodle's calendar. CourseLink captures assignments from the syllabus PDF, which often includes deadlines professors don't enter into Moodle.

    How do I find my syllabus in Moodle?

    In Moodle, open your course and look in the General section at the top of the course page, or check under Resources or Course Documents. The syllabus is typically uploaded as a PDF. Download it and upload it to CourseLink.
